  • Patent number: 11840959
    Abstract: A unison ring of a gas turbine engine includes: an annular body including fiber-reinforced resin or circular-arc bodies including the fiber-reinforced resin, the fiber-reinforced resin including resin and reinforced fibers; and pin holes in which a pin is in a radial direction orthogonal to an axial direction of the unison ring. A main orientation of the reinforced fibers of the fiber-reinforced resin is directed in a circumferential direction of the unison ring.

  • Patent number: 11247752
    Abstract: A double-shell tank includes: an inner shell storing liquefied gas; an outer shell surrounding the inner shell, the outer shell forming a vacuum space between the inner shell and the outer shell; at least one metal sheet mounted to the inner shell, such that the metal sheet faces at least a bottom surface of the inner shell; an adsorbent placed on the metal sheet, the adsorbent adsorbing gas molecules by physisorption; and a thermal insulator covering the inner shell over the metal sheet.

  • Patent number: 10947038
    Abstract: A thermal insulating structure includes: at least two retainers that protrude from a to-be-insulated surface exposed to a vacuum space; at least two first multilayer vacuum insulating sheets adjacent to each other with the retainers positioned therebetween, the insulating sheets covering the to-be-insulated surface; at least one second multilayer vacuum insulating sheet that extends between the retainers along a boundary between the first multilayer vacuum insulating sheets in a manner to cover the boundary; at least two third multilayer vacuum insulating sheets that are adjacent to each other with the retainers positioned therebetween, the at least two third multilayer vacuum insulating sheets covering the first multilayer vacuum insulating sheets and the second multilayer vacuum insulating sheet; and a keep plate that is fixed to the retainers and holds the first multilayer vacuum insulating sheets, the second multilayer vacuum insulating sheet, and the third multilayer vacuum insulating sheets.

  • Patent number: 10317010
    Abstract: A liquefied gas storage tank includes: an inner shell storing a liquefied gas; an outer shell forming a vacuum space between the inner shell and the outer shell; and a fail-safe thermal insulating layer covering an outer side surface of the outer shell. According to this configuration, the fail-safe thermal insulating layer is not disposed in the vacuum space. This makes it possible to suppress the degradation over time of the degree of vacuum in the vacuum space.

  • Patent number: 10207775
    Abstract: A horizontal type cylindrical double-shell tank includes an inner shell and an outer shell. The inner shell includes an inner shell main part storing a liquefied gas and an inner shell dome protruding from the inner shell main part. The outer shell forms a vacuum space between the inner shell and the outer shell, and includes an outer shell main part surrounding the inner shell main part and an outer shell dome surrounding the inner shell dome. The inner shell dome is provided with an inner shell manhole. The outer shell dome is provided with an outer shell manhole at a position corresponding to a position of the inner shell manhole.

  • Patent number: 9656729
    Abstract: A structure of a horizontal type cylindrical double-shell tank mounted on a ship includes: an inner shell storing liquefied gas; and an outer shell forming a vacuum space between the inner shell and the outer shell. A pair of support units supporting the inner shell is disposed between the inner shell and the outer shell. Each support unit includes: a plurality of cylindrical elements arranged in a circumferential direction of the tank such that an axial direction of each of the cylindrical elements coincides with a radial direction of the tank; a plurality of inner members each holding an end portion of a corresponding one of the cylindrical elements at the inner shell side; and a plurality of outer members each holding an end portion of a corresponding one of the cylindrical elements at the outer shell side. Each of the cylindrical elements is made of glass fiber reinforced plastic.

  • Patent number: 9587787
    Abstract: A support structure of a ship tank includes: a curved surface facing an outer peripheral surface of a horizontal type cylindrical tank; and a pair of support units supporting the tank on the curved surface. Each of the support units includes: a plurality of cylindrical elements arranged in a circumferential direction of the tank such that an axial direction of each of the cylindrical elements coincides with a radial direction of the tank; a plurality of inner members each holding an end portion of a corresponding one of the cylindrical elements at the tank side; and a plurality of outer members each holding an end portion of a corresponding one of the cylindrical elements at an opposite side to the tank. The inner members are fixed to the tank. The outer members of one of the support units are configured such that displacement of the outer members in an axial direction of the tank relative to the curved surface is restricted.
